Output 84d834da14a53e9c323f4d7d415371bb360d74f17f04c0cfd73599409dbd4543:0

value
12649928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ef4d893d27b1f05262ac740ebbb4eb8bca2266a5 OP_EQUALVERIFY OP_CHECKSIG
address
1NpKP9fcEepa5mCa2mV7T8N2WNeXzjUuwk
transaction
84d834da14a53e9c323f4d7d415371bb360d74f17f04c0cfd73599409dbd4543
spent
true